Introduction of O1 Lite by Open Interpreter

Open Interpreter introduced the O1 Lite, a portable voice interface device meant to interact with AI physically. This hardware aims to establish a new way for users to engage with AI agents, moving beyond screens. The software side of the product runs locally on computers, acting as an agent for interaction. The device sparked excitement, evidenced by its rapid sell-out within hours.
